When it helps

A watermark ties the image to your name before you publish it, and makes it harder to reuse without crediting you.

Common questions

Does Arabic text appear correctly?

Yes. Letters join the way Arabic is actually read, so the mark looks right rather than a row of disconnected characters.

What do "start" and "end" mean for the position?

Start is the side reading begins from: the right in Arabic, the left in English. We name it that way so the position stays correct in both languages.

Does this change the image dimensions?

No. The mark is drawn onto the image at its original size, with no cropping or shrinking.
